Vladislao I o Ladislao I (en checo: Vladislav I.; 1065-1125), duque de Bohemia desde 1109 a 1117 y de 1120 hasta el 12 de abril, de 1125 como príncipe de la dinastía premislida. [1] Ladislao I era hijo del duque, más tarde rey, Vladislao II de Bohemia y de su segunda esposa Swatawa, hija de Casimiro I de Polonia. [2]
